Transaction 90e76382950143b5262941e561546f95668498bffc272921d9b9e1e9d7cfdd62
1 Input
1 Output
-
90e76382950143b5262941e561546f95668498bffc272921d9b9e1e9d7cfdd62:0
- value
- 440064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c15beac3151f2cf089d29a3fe0859c51c4b87c95 OP_EQUAL
- address
- 3KKQT5J8H9b16JrttMqquDWUtPqCTefhkA